Flood insurance typically does not cover foundation repairs directly. Flood insurance policies are designed to protect homeowners from damage caused by flooding, which can include damage to the structure of the home, its contents, and any attached fixtures like plumbing and electrical systems. Homeowners undertake home improvement projects to make repairs, add to their existing space, or make substantial upgrades. While the improvements will eventually raise the value of your home, they will also raise your homeowners insurance premiums.
